About the role

Job Description:

The Product Diagnostic & Quality Center (PDQC) is seeking a Failure Analysis (FA) Software Development Engineer with strong expertise in software tool development. The successful candidate will be responsible for building, implementing, and maintaining end‑to‑end software solutions used daily by FA and Reliability engineers across global PDQC labs for efficient analysis of NXP products.

Key Responsibilities

  • Develop, and maintain software tools (GUI and automation) to support Failure Analysis and Reliability teams
  • Collaborate with the global NXP teams to understand workflows, user experience needs, and technical requirements to ensure intuitive and efficient software tool solutions
  • Design and integrate software with lab infrastructure and equipment (e.g., ATE, measurement/analysis tools) and implement flow automation and data capture using relevant APIs and scripting

Qualifications & Skills

  • Bachelor’s degree in Computer Science, Software Engineering, or a related field (or equivalent), with 2+ years of hands‑on software development experience
  • Strong programming proficiency in Python and Java, including data processing and automation; experience with Tcl and Linux shell scripting is an advantage
  • Proficiency with software engineering tools and practices, including Git/Bitbucket, branching strategies, code reviews, debugging, and Jira for issue tracking
  • Proven problem-solving and debugging abilities, with a track record of optimizing software solutions
  • Excellent English communication skills, capable of producing clear technical documentation and conveying complex topics effectively in discussions
  • Comfortable working in a semiconductor lab environment and collaborating with global teams across FA, Reliability, Design, and Test
  • Able to work independently, manage priorities, and drive tasks to closure

Programming Languages:

Relevant hands-on experience with the following languages/scripting environments is an advantage:

  • Python (advantage)
  • Java (advantage)
  • Tcl
  • Shell scripting
  • C/C++

Tools & Software Experience:

Experience with EDA/DFT-related tools used in debug and diagnosis flows is an advantage:

  • Cadence PVS
  • Siemens Calibre
  • Synopsys Avalon
  • Siemens Tessent Diagnosis

Experience integrating software with ATE environments and related data formats (e.g., test logs, pattern sources such as STIL) is an advantage:

  • SmarTest 7, SmarTest 8
  • IGXL
  • STIL
  • Diamond Cohu ITE

The Failure Analysis Enablement Team, part of the Product Diagnostic & Quality Center (PDQC) within NXP Global Quality, develops and maintains hardware and software solutions that enable on-time failure analysis readiness for every NXP product. By supporting comprehensive product analysis from development through end-of-life, the team helps ensure top-tier product quality for NXP customers.

The FA Enablement Team supports PDQC locations worldwide, including Austin (USA), Bangkok (Thailand), Kaohsiung (Taiwan), Kuala Lumpur (Malaysia), Nijmegen (Netherlands), and Tianjin (China), helping drive consistent and high-quality failure analysis across the organization.
